In this episode of Ready Your Future, Todd draws powerful parallels between the Pilgrims' journey and modern preparedness, demonstrating how their story offers crucial lessons for today's preppers facing potential SHTF scenarios. Their experience proves that true preparedness goes far beyond stockpiling supplies—it requires developing practical skills, building strong community bonds, and cultivating the psychological resilience needed to adapt when everything goes wrong. Todd emphasizes how the ability to adapt when plans catastrophically fail mirrors the flexibility modern preppers must develop. The episode reminds us that whether facing religious persecution in 1620 or economic uncertainty today, the principles remain the same: adaptability, community cooperation, and maintaining gratitude even in hardship are the true foundations of survival and the ability to thrive beyond mere existence.
